Alexander Alvina Chamberland is an avant-garde filmmaker and artist known for exploring themes of queerness, identity, and politics through their work. Chamberland's films often blend experimental techniques with thought-provoking narratives, challenging conventional storytelling methods. While their filmography may not be widely recognized in mainstream cinema, they have garnered attention in independent film circuits and queer film festivals. Notable projects include "Queer Punk Movie" and "Parallel Lines Converge in Infinity," which have been praised for their unique aesthetic and daring subject matter. Chamberland's contributions have made significant impacts within their niche, celebrating and amplifying underrepresented voices.
